a. [ Uni- + lateral: cf. F. unilatéral. ] 1. Being on one side only; affecting but one side; one-sided. [ 1913 Webster ]
2. (Biol.) Pertaining to one side; one-sided; as, a unilateral raceme, in which the flowers grow only on one side of a common axis, or are all turned to one side. [ 1913 Webster ]
Unilateral contract (Law), a contract or engagement requiring future action only by one party. [ 1913 Webster ]
